The WNBA announced Saturday that the fan who threw a lime green sex toy onto the court during the Atlanta Dream’s game earlier this week has been arrested.

The league stated that any fan who throws objects during a game will be immediately ejected and face a minimum one-year ban, along with potential arrest and prosecution.

The incident occurred in the fourth quarter of the Dream’s 77–75 loss to the Valkyries on Tuesday, causing a stoppage in play. A referee kicked the object aside before a police officer removed it.

“The safety and well-being of everyone in our arenas is a top priority,” the league said. “Objects thrown onto the court can pose serious risks to players, officials, and fans.”

A nearly identical incident happened again Friday night during a Valkyries-Sky game, when a similar object was tossed in the third quarter. It’s not yet known whether an arrest was made in that case.

Several players have voiced frustration. Sky center Elizabeth Williams called the behavior “super disrespectful” and “immature,” urging the person responsible to “grow up.”

Liberty forward Isabelle Harrison criticized the venue’s lack of response, writing on X: “ARENA SECURITY?! Hello??! Please do better. It’s not funny. Never was. Throwing ANYTHING on the court is so dangerous.”
